Hi All,
I'm using the following code for memcache for smarty caching.
PHP: 5.6.26
Smarty: 3.1.31 (via composer)
Memcache: 1.4.4
Plugin: https://github.com/smarty-php/smarty/blob/master/demo/plugins/cacheresource.memcache.php
Code: |
$rootDir = (dirname(__DIR__));
define("ROOTPATH", $rootDir);
$vendorPath = ROOTPATH . "/vendor";
$frontEndDir = ROOTPATH . "/frontend";
require_once $vendorPath . '/autoload.php';
$smarty = new Smarty();
$smarty->caching_type = 'memcache';
$smarty->compile_dir = $frontEndDir . '/test/templates_c';
$smarty->cache_dir = $frontEndDir . '/test/templates_c/cache';
$smarty->template_dir = $frontEndDir . '/test/templates/';
$smarty->plugins_dir = ROOTPATH . "/smarty_plugins";
//$smarty->clearAllCache();
$smarty->caching = 2;
$smarty->cache_lifetime = (mktime(0, 0, 0, date('n'), date('j') + 1) - time());
$isCached = $smarty->isCached('test.tpl', 'test');
if (!$isCached) {
$smarty->assign('test', "Memcache Test");
} else {
echo "No cache";
}
$smarty->display("test.tpl", 'test');
|
test.tpl
Code: |
<b>{$test|lower}</b>
|
Error:
SmartyCompilerException: Syntax error in template "file:/home/www/test/templates/test.tpl" on line 1 "<b>{$test|lower}</b>" unknown modifier "lower" in /home/www/vendor/smarty/smarty/libs/sysplugins/smarty_internal_templatecompilerbase.php on line 1
Kindly help me to resole this issue. |

mods-2017-03-20.php5
Code: | <?php
require 'init.php';
$smarty->display(__FILE__);
__halt_compiler();
?>PHP {$smarty.const.PHP_VERSION}
Smarty {$smarty.version}
"Test"|upper: {"Test"|upper}
"Test"|lower: {"Test"|lower}
"Test truncated"|truncate:7: {"Test truncated"|truncate:7:"…"} |
Code: | PHP 5.6.30
Smarty 3.1.31
"Test"|upper: TEST
"Test"|lower: test
"Test truncated"|truncate:7: Test… |
PHP 7.0 same results. Check your autoloading settings. |
